Bio

Domino Affect, Sheba’s 5th album is in the running for a 2009 Grammy nomination! She is a NAACP Image Award Nominee for works in Home Girls Make Some Noise. Published:Essence, Old Dominion University’s Poets Journal, S. Florida University Urban Griot, Portfolio Magazine, The Syracuse University Women in Hip-Hop & National artist for Rolling Out, Creative Loafing, & thousands of online journals.Taught/Teaches; in over 200 colleges & universities. Toured:West Africa, Europe, Cuba, Canada & coffee house to coliseum in the US. Seen: BBC London, 106&Park,VH-1,The Apollo. In short: 60 seconds or less
 
Think you can’t get diversity, sexy, soul, world music, exciting, entertaining, sassy, classy and intelligent all in one package?! You must not have met Queen Sheba!
 
 
Even before Queen Sheba was named one of the #1 Ranked Poets in the World, a veteran member of the two time championship winning Slam Charlotte National Poetry Slam Team, she hasn’t (and won’t) stopped moving.
 
From Ghana to Compton, from coffee house to concert halls, from night clubs to coliseums, Queen Sheba has taught and performed in 8 countries and 3 Continents; Including appearances in Cuba, PanaFest in Ghana, West Africa, Winner of the 4 Nations International Team Slam Champion-Oxford England, performing for the troops on the US Air Force base in K-Town Germany and a teaching residency at the University of Ill, Urbana-Champaign.
 
Sheba's literary training has landed her a feature in Rolling Out Atlanta, and she previously won the VA Individual Artist Fellowship Award, has been published in Essence, Vibe, The Syracuse University Anthology "Home girls make some noise", The Southern Griot University of South Florida, Skipping Stones Anthology of Hampton
Roads Poets 4-years running a plethora of online interviews, websites and journals.
 
Recently paired up, no pun intended, with a major shoe company to bring Poetry Slams to 5 major cities, Queen Sheba has released two new music videos, (that’s right! Spoken Word artists are doing music videos! You better catch up!) was selected to perform for the Rolling Stone’s 500 Songs for Kids campaign, Sheba also was picked to be the 2007 BET Lyric Café’s Featured Poet, works recently nominated for the NAACP Image Award as a part of the Check The Rhyme anthology from Lit Noire Publishing in Nyc and 2006's Just Plain Folk's Spoken Word Album of the Year; That’s just the beginning.
 
 
In Stores-Online –Out the Trunk: While just releasing two new music videos to BET, VH-1 Soul and MTV UK, Domino Affect, Sheba's highly anticipated, recently released 5th album, whispers surprise appearances by, unexpected multi-platinum recording artists and other artists Too Good for Mainstream, was released Sept 8th 2007 , Domino Affect, and any one of her 4 previous albums can be heard and downloaded by millions on any mass media outlet, including, iTunes, Sunday Night Talks with Chuck D, XM Radio, from the Morning show with the Supreme Team on Clear Channel, your local Hip-Hop and alternative stations to classic jazz and world wide internet radio.
 
Without a place for Spoken Word artists to call home, the Queen did want most geniuses do, invent a way. Her ambition earned her the tenured CEO position of Oya Xclusive International a record label for poets; boasting 6 albums, a 7-year event planning and consulting company, organizer and co-founder of Akoben: Words-In-Action
International Music and Poetry Festival. Rewarded for their commitment to the community, Akoben has been ranked as one of the top 10 world fusion festivals to visit. Top honors include New Orleans Mayor Ray Nagin as he declared every 2nd weekend in October, officially: Akoben Weekend.
 
Notably one of the hardest working and more business savvy artists Below the Radar, Queen Sheba partnered with multifaceted event planners and introduced the Twisted Tongue Poetry and Concert series to Atlanta late 2006 with all sold out shows to boot. This premiere adult event has artists and eager audience members buying tickets and booking flights from across the country months in advance.
